ECoR Cancels 12 Trains For Safety Works From Feb 1 To 4; Details Here

Bhubaneswar: The East Coast Railway (ECoR) has cancelled and partially cancelled some trains under its jurisdiction between February 1 and 4.

The ECoR, in a release on Saturday, said the step has been taken in view of safety related modernisation work at Hijli railway station under Kharagpur Division in West Bengal .
